Transaction 27b527e48e5914f060824d9e68bf0e21e74d05abb69803182bfc45eb94b7cf87

1 Input
2 Outputs
  • 27b527e48e5914f060824d9e68bf0e21e74d05abb69803182bfc45eb94b7cf87:0
  • value  5416547363
    address  3GEm5ixwHEZWencjo8eYTmHDKNaQqYFMwa
  • 27b527e48e5914f060824d9e68bf0e21e74d05abb69803182bfc45eb94b7cf87:1
  • value  269666660
    address  372xN3H9gdWJjB6AmiaNwn6ZGDTUNxtdHX